WebOct 13, 2024 · bi-weekly (adj.) also biweekly , 1865, from bi- "two, twice" + weekly . The sense of "twice a week" is the earliest attested, but that of "every two weeks" is equally implied and preferred, the "twice-a-week" meaning going with semi-weekly . WebJul 31, 2024 · Biweekly noun. Something that is published or released once every two weeks. ‘The local paper is a biweekly.’;

These papers are published weekly, bi-weekly or monthly. WebBusinesses that operate a biweekly payroll must pay their employees every other week on a specified day of the week. This means that the employees of the business will receive a total of 26 paychecks annually. Biweekly payrolls are different from bimonthly payrolls because they take weeks as a base rather than months. ctclink login page highline college https://mihperformance.com

WebMar 7, 2024 · A bi-weekly pay schedule is the most commonly used pay period by employers. The schedule is determined by the business, with payment issued to employees on a set day, every other week. On a bi-weekly payroll calendar, employees receive 26 paychecks a year, 27 in a leap year. Web1. : happening every two weeks. The biweekly [= ( chiefly Brit) fortnightly] sales meeting is scheduled for every other Tuesday. 2. : happening twice a week : semiweekly.
